Output 93e5f99f80c845412ae428535e68c2743b1f859b55a08e5533ddf24f91675634:27

value
17004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09cc9e07ab865a5ff5ff9dd0222add69c9b3c71b OP_EQUAL
address
32aq8L5fMCkw5MXG567sW9XGjZv4Lzm7aN
transaction
93e5f99f80c845412ae428535e68c2743b1f859b55a08e5533ddf24f91675634
confirmations
264811
spent
true